<span>In the 1992 national elections, Democratic candidate Bill Clinton
a. campaigned as a "new Democrat" who proposed to move away from his party's traditional liberalism.

</span><span>2. A principal constituency that voted heavily for Bill Clinton over President Bush and H.Ross Perot was
e.  women

On that second question, some detail:  45% of women voting in the 1992 election voted for Clinton, compared to 38% for Bush and 17% for Perot.  And overall more women than men voted in 1992.  53% of the total voter turnout were women.
